0 V analog-to-digital interface for CCD cameras Preliminary specification Supersedes data of 1998 Mar 27 File under Integrated Circuits, IC02 1998 Oct 15 Philips Semiconductors Preliminary specification 10-bit, 3.
0 V analog-to-digital interface for CCD cameras FEATURES • Correlated Double Sampling (CDS), Automatic Gain Control (AGC), 10-bit Analog-to-Digital Converter (ADC) and reference regulator included • Fully programmable via a 3-wire serial interface • Sampling frequency up to 18 MHz • AGC gain range of 36 dB (in steps of 0.
1 dB) • Low power consumption of only 190 mW (typ.
) • Power consumption in standby mode of 4.
5 mW (typ.
) • 3.
0 V operation and 2.
5 to 3.
6 V operation for the digital outputs • Active control pulses polarity selectable via serial interface • 8-bit DAC included for analog settings • TTL compatible inputs, CMOS compatible outputs.

25 190 APPLICATIONS TDA8787 • Low-power, low-voltage CCD camera systems.
GENERAL DESCRIPTION The TDA8787 is a 10-bit analog-to-digital interface for CCD cameras.
The device includes a correlated double sampling circuit, AGC and a low-power 10-bit ADC together with its reference voltage regulator.
AGC gain is controlled via the serial interface.
